Rep. Andrew Clyde, who serves Georgia's 9th District in the U.S. Congress, shared a series of messages expressing his stance on legislative and public safety issues. Clyde, born in Walkerton, Ontario, Canada, graduated from notable universities and has served in Congress since 2021.

On March 26, 2025, Rep. Clyde commented, "Disappointing is an understatement—but this isn’t the end. I’ll be leading the fight to DEFUND this unconstitutional Biden-era rule. Stay tuned."

The following morning on March 27, he posted, "BREAKING: Early this morning, the Trump Administration arrested a top MS-13 leader in Virginia. THANK YOU, @POTUS, @AGPamBondi, @FBIDirectorKash, and @RealTomHoman for keeping Americans safe!"

Later the same day, Clyde announced the reintroduction of a legislative proposal in a tweet: "Today I reintroduced the SHORT Act to remove SBRs, SBSs, and AOWs from the draconian NFA. This solution ensures Americans are not subjected to unconstitutional restrictions, taxation, and registration of firearms and pistol braces. I’ll never stop fighting to protect 2A rights."
